Ingredients
2 litre(s)
Sorbet
- 750 g Mulled Wine, as per EDC
- 250 g water
- 180 g sugar
- 1 eggwhite, (or 50g meringue)
- 300 g pears, roughly chopped
- 1 lime, peeled (or lemon)
Recipe's preparation
Prepare mulled wine as per EDC
Strain through the TM basket by placing basket inside bowl and pouring into jug or bowl
Weigh 750g mulled wine and add 250g water
Pour into icecube trays and freeze until solid (8 hrs or longer)
Place sugar in the bowl and mill for 10 sec on speed 9
Add eggwhite, pears and lime and puree for 5 secs speed 7
Add mulled wine icecubes and blend for 1 minute on speed 9, using spatula to assist when required. (add additional water or mulled wine if requires loosening during this process)

Tip
If doing at a cooking class ommit the eggwhite for meringues
Using water to dilute the final product of mulled wine after straining will aid the freezing. Alcohol and sugar do not freeze as solid if not diluted, it also is a more sublte flavour
Pears work well for Christmas in July, as they are in season. At Christmas time, try some summer fruits like tamarillo.
